CODE Korea embodies the essence of Korean culture, fashion, design, and experience. As the guest nation of Pitti Uomo 108, and promoted by the Korea Creative Content Agency (KOCCA), which supports the global expansion of K-pop, K-drama, webtoons, and other Korean content, CODE Korea will present not only fashion but also a broad showcase of contemporary Korean culture within the Polveriera space.
The brands featured in the special CODE Korea project will be Ajobyajo, Finoacinque, Jagoryu, Montsenu, Ordinary People, Okiio Lounge, Valoren, and MAN.G Studio. These brands will engage in networking with global buyers and showcase K-fashion’s industrial potential worldwide by presenting innovative technical fabrics and digital content.

AJOBYAJO

Ajobyajo is a brand that expresses Asia’s subculture as street wear with the sensibility of an outsider. Just as streetwear captures the culture of the time, Ajobyajo captures the culture of Asia’s minorities, creating collections inspired by their culture. This is why various people, not professional models, appear in Ajobyajo's images. Ajobyajo introduces mix-and-match and layered looks of multiple materials based on oversized. Just as various cultures coexist simultaneously, different styles coexist within the Ajobyajo style, harmonizing and colliding with each other to create the unique Ajobyajo style.

Finoacinque is a shoe brand founded by designer Angela Lee and technician Zuun Kim in 2019. The philosophy of the brand is to believe that shoes are the foundation of every journey, the rhythm of every step. They are more than just an accessory to wear; they are a form of self-expression. Shoes are more than a functional necessity; Finoacinque shoes carry memories and meaning. Finoacinque brings together looking great and feeling good, living creatively, and walking comfortably. "We don't just make shoes, we craft experiences" is the motto of the brand.

Based in Seoul, Montsenu is a ready-to-wear brand that interprets the spirit of the times with a focus on sustainability. The brand's identity is rooted in the meaning "dreaming of a new world," highlighting the ambivalent and irrational characteristics of romance with the motto "Harmony in Chaos". Montsenu aims to transcend gender and era, drawing inspiration from cultural and artistic experimentation and historical paradigms, and reinterpreting traditional concepts through contemporary and experimental aesthetics. Montsenu's vision is to employ an architectural approach to design structured silhouettes, free-spirited patterns, mystical colors, unique textures, and handcrafted embellishments.

Valoren is a designer brand that aims for "Refined Deconstruction." Even in the dismantling elements, the core of the design is to capture balanced beauty and elaborate details, and it gives the impression of being free and rough on the surface of the clothes, but it constantly agonizes over carefully designed structures and refined emotions. The brand name Valoren is a combination of Valore, which means "value" in Italian, and N (and), which means "value" and contains the philosophy of "branding to create and share value." The gender-bound silhouette, the dismantling yet structural detail, and the sharp completeness felt in the texture and finish are key components of Valoren's design language.

Previously known as MAN.G, the brand has rebranded and evolved into MAN.G Studio, opening a bold new chapter in its creative journey. MAN.G Studio is a unisex brand that seamlessly blends street aesthetics with classic tailoring, all anchored in a signature black-based palette. The collections feature oversized jackets, innerwear, and refined womenswear pieces, such as dresses, shirts, and skirts, infused with the brand’s signature witty and artistic graphic details. The thoughtful incorporation of unique artwork and gender-neutral silhouettes broadens the brand’s appeal, distinguishing MAN.G Studio from fast-moving trends and offering timeless style with a creative edge.
